Transaction 81d03b0ee2cd78cc510a3353541ab492536f9c944e00493fca4c426a8fa06d25

1 Input
2 Outputs
  • 81d03b0ee2cd78cc510a3353541ab492536f9c944e00493fca4c426a8fa06d25:0
  • value  1980000
    address  31sJpgB9pcTg68RhVyynBQ3rb4qkW4wG95
  • 81d03b0ee2cd78cc510a3353541ab492536f9c944e00493fca4c426a8fa06d25:1
  • value  27206782
    address  1Fa8WaCjPpXbokspSUR3J1u6UWnBrUBBNh